Students with prior experience in French can contact the French undergraduate adviser to select the appropriate beginning course. Also offered by BYU Independent Study; enroll anytime throughout year; one year to complete; additional tuition required.

Title

Speaking

Learning Outcome

Speak French well enough to satisfy immediate needs. (You will learn to communicate in basic social situations, meet routine travel needs, obtain food and lodging, carry out simple transactions, and talk about a variety of topics of common interest primarily in the present, with limited use of other time frames.)

Title

Writing

Learning Outcome

Write short messages and well-articulated sentences in French on familiar topics.
